Production Line Leader (Food, FTC)

We are recruiting for Line Leaders to join our client based in Westbury, Wiltshire. With an starting hourly rate of £14.28 per hour. This will initially be a fixed term contract till the end of the year, but for the right candidate permanent opportunities could be available.

Pay and Hours
  • Pay: £14.28-£21.42 per hour
  • Starting rate is £14.28 per hour with overtime paid at 1.5x after 37.75 hours
  • Working Hours: Monday to Friday (From November till the end of the year working hours will increase to 12 hours shifts Monday to Friday 07:00 - 19:00 or Sunday to Thursday)
  • During peak times this rate will increase but the increased pay rate is still TBC
Responsibilities
  • Supervise and coordinate daily activities of the production line team to ensure smooth operations.
  • Monitor production processes to maintain high standards of quality and efficiency.
  • Ensure compliance with HACCP (Hazard Analysis Critical Control Point) guidelines and food safety regulations.
  • Conduct regular inspections of equipment and work areas to ensure cleanliness and adherence to safety protocols.
  • Provide training and support to team members on food production techniques and safety practices.
  • Collaborate with management to identify areas for improvement in production processes.
  • Maintain accurate records of production metrics and report any discrepancies or issues promptly.
Qualifications
  • Familiarity with HACCP principles and food safety regulations is essential.
  • Previous experience in food production is highly desirable.
  • Excellent leadership skills with the ability to motivate and guide a diverse team.
  • Strong communication skills, both verbal and written, for effective collaboration with team members and management.
